IBEX 2022 features new networking opportunities, special events

by National Marine Manufacturers Association 2 Sep 2022 02:35 PDT 27-29 September 2022
IBEX Networking © National Marine Manufacturers Association

IBEX 2022, set for September 27-29 in Tampa, features a robust schedule of networking and special events, including a host of new opportunities, to connect marine industry professionals.

New for 2022, on Wednesday, September 28, the Emerging Marine Leaders (EMLs) will present the Strengthening Leadership through Brand Development and Networking session, hosted by Boating Industry. Attendees can connect, learn, and share by joining EMLs and industry veterans during this two-part event. Programming will begin with a presentation from Marissa Russo, Assistant Director of Career Readiness, University of Tampa. Through an activity-based approach, attendees will engage in topics around the importance of building a personal brand, networking with leadership and mentorship. Following, these newly developed skills will be used during a private social networking event. The program is free to attend. Registration to the event is requested by clicking here.
